Hickory Hardware Twist Series pull gives cabinets a shaped look using a harmonious twist and undulating curves, so doors and drawers gain visual depth instead of a flat, straight line. The satin nickel finish provides a muted metallic surface, which helps this pull coordinate with many hinge and appliance finishes in the same tone family. The pull is part of the Twist collection, so the design follows organic lines found in nature and contemporary architecture, tying together modern casework that still needs softer contours. Made from zinc, the pull offers a solid metal feel in daily use, which supports repeated opening and closing on busy cabinet runs. With a 7-9/16 inch (192 mm) center to center length, this pull spans wider drawer fronts or tall doors, helping spread the hand contact area across more of the face.
The 7-9/16 inch (192 mm) center to center dimension sets the screw hole spacing for this satin nickel pull, so it matches layouts drilled to that standard spread across cabinet fronts. This fixed spacing suits metric-based 192 mm runs often used on longer drawers, helping align multiple pulls in a straight line on banks of fronts. With an overall length of 8-1/4 inches, the pull slightly overhangs the mounting centers, which frames the screw locations and gives a balanced margin at each end. The 1-1/8 inch projection keeps the hand away from the cabinet surface while still holding the pull close, which supports tight walkways where hardware cannot protrude too far. The 5/8 inch width defines a slim profile, so installers can position the pull near door edges without visually crowding the stile layout.
